    About this Episode

    In this podcast, senior software developer Christopher Keefer shares his insights on a "Legacy" codebase and the different approaches you can take toward a legacy transition. We even talk a bit about the impact of legacy software on the healthcare industry and what it means to have a properly air-gapped computer.

    How can you make HVAC more efficient? There's an app for that.

    In this podcast, we’ll be talking about HVAC and the web application that Art+Logic developed for Rheia. We'll discuss how the app helps store and standardize the kinds of measurements that go into ensuring that a conditioned room gets the proper airflow. Joining this podcast are Robert Beach, from Rheia, along with Stan Bartilson and Samuel Kison from Art+Logic. We’ll be discussing the need for more efficient ductwork in new and existing homes, the impact of the pandemic on Rheia’s air distribution systems, and the benefits of passing conditioned air through conditioned rooms rather than through hot attics or other unconditioned spaces.

    What is Ransomware?

    So, what is ransomware and can we prevent it from hitting us? In the wake of the Colonial Pipeline attack, the impact of ransomware has become more obvious than ever to the general population. There's heightened anxiety about being vulnerable to an attack and concerns have grown about how to react when it happens. In this podcast, I'll speak with Jeff Stice-Hall, an expert in software security, about ransomware, Darkside, and how his child's school responded to a ransomware attack.
